FAQS about Grid fire energy storage

Are battery energy storage systems a fire hazard mitigation strategy?

The challenges of providing effective fire and explosion hazard mitigation strategies for Battery Energy Storage Systems (BESS) are receiving appreciable attention, given that renewable energy production has evolved significantly in recent years and is projected to account for 80% of new power generation capacity in 2030 (WEO, 2023).

What are battery energy storage systems?

Battery energy storage systems that suck up cheap power during periods of low demand, then discharge it at a profit during periods of high demand, are considered critical with the rise of intermittent energy sources such as wind and solar.

What is the battery energy storage system guidebook?

A public benefit corporation, NYSERDA has been advancing energy solutions and working to protect the environment since 1975. The Battery Energy Storage System Guidebook contains information, tools, and step-by-step instructions to support local governments managing battery energy storage system development in their communities.

Are battery energy storage systems safe?

But as more energy storage is added, residents in some places are pushing back due to fears that the systems will go up in flames, as a massive facility in California did earlier this year. Proponents maintain that state-of-the-art battery energy storage systems are safe, but more localities are enacting moratoriums.

China-based rolling stock manufacturer CRRC has launched a 5 MWh battery storage system that uses liquid cooling for thermal management.. China-based rolling stock manufacturer CRRC has launched a 5 MWh battery storage system that uses liquid cooling for thermal management.. The world's largest rolling stock manufacturer says that its new container storage system uses LFP cells with a 3.2 V/314 Ah capacity. The system also features a DC voltage range of 1,081.6 V to 1,497.6 V. From ESS News China-based rolling stock manufacturer CRRC has launched a 5 MWh battery. . nces power supply reliability.
